well the point of the bypass shocks is to provide extra dampening to help slow the rebound down and help with the large jumps while still having a plush and soft suspension. the bypass shocks are supose to have no resistance. its just like a normal shock without a spring. if you are trying to save weight i wouldnt use them unless it bottoms out real bad.
